在当今这个信息爆炸的时代,农业领域也在经历着一场前所未有的变革。随着现代数据技术的飞速发展,如何将这些技术应用于农业,提高农田的效率,成为了众多农业从业者关注的焦点。本文将深入探讨现代数据技术在农业中的应用,以及如何让农田更高效。
数据驱动农业:从传统到现代的转变
1. 农业大数据的兴起
农业大数据是指从农业生产、管理、销售等各个环节中收集、处理、分析的大量数据。这些数据包括土壤、气候、作物生长、市场行情等。随着物联网、传感器等技术的普及,农业大数据的获取变得更加容易。
2. 数据分析在农业中的应用
数据分析可以帮助农民了解作物的生长状况、土壤肥力、病虫害等信息,从而做出更科学的决策。例如,通过分析土壤数据,可以精确施肥,提高肥料利用率;通过分析气候数据,可以预测天气变化,合理安排农事活动。
现代数据技术在农田中的应用
1. 物联网技术
物联网技术可以将农田中的各种设备连接起来,实现实时监测和数据采集。例如,智能灌溉系统可以根据土壤湿度自动调节灌溉量,节约水资源。
# 智能灌溉系统示例代码
class SmartIrrigationSystem:
def __init__(self, soil_moisture_sensor):
self.soil_moisture_sensor = soil_moisture_sensor
def check_moisture(self):
moisture_level = self.soil_moisture_sensor.get_moisture_level()
if moisture_level < 30:
self.irrigate()
else:
print("土壤湿度适宜,无需灌溉。")
def irrigate(self):
print("开始灌溉...")
# 灌溉操作代码
print("灌溉完成。")
# 假设的土壤湿度传感器
class SoilMoistureSensor:
def get_moisture_level(self):
# 获取土壤湿度等级
return 25
# 创建智能灌溉系统实例
soil_moisture_sensor = SoilMoistureSensor()
smart_irrigation_system = SmartIrrigationSystem(soil_moisture_sensor)
smart_irrigation_system.check_moisture()
2. 无人机技术
无人机可以用于农田监测、病虫害防治、播种等环节。例如,无人机可以携带摄像头对农田进行实时监测,及时发现病虫害问题。
3. 人工智能技术
人工智能技术可以帮助农民分析大量数据,预测作物产量、市场行情等。例如,通过机器学习算法,可以预测作物生长趋势,为农民提供决策依据。
现代数据技术对农业的深远影响
1. 提高农业生产效率
现代数据技术可以帮助农民提高农业生产效率,降低生产成本。例如,通过精确施肥、合理灌溉,可以减少肥料和水的浪费。
2. 促进农业可持续发展
现代数据技术可以帮助农民实现资源的合理利用,减少对环境的污染。例如,通过监测土壤肥力,可以避免过度施肥,减少对土壤的破坏。
3. 增强农业竞争力
随着全球农业市场的竞争日益激烈,现代数据技术可以帮助农民提高产品质量,增强市场竞争力。
总之,现代数据技术在农业中的应用,为农业升级提供了强大的动力。相信在不久的将来,农业将迎来一个全新的时代。
